In an interview with Al Jazeera, Ali Vaez of the International Crisis Group stated Iran is unlikely to accept US demands, warning the conflict could destabilise the entire region. He revealed Trump authorised Israel’s attack just days before planned US-Iran talks in Muscat, creating a contradiction between diplomatic overtures and military action. Vaez explained that from Tehran’s perspective, surrendering to Trump’s terms would risk regime collapse, making continued resistance preferable despite the bombardment. He cautioned that a cornered Iranian leadership might escalate regionally if pushed to the brink. Vaez emphasised Tehran views current US demands as an existential slippery slope rather than a negotiable compromise. With diplomacy undermined by simultaneous attacks, Vaez suggested the risk of wider war is now higher than ever. His assessment highlights how miscalculations could spiral beyond the Israel-Iran theatre.
